How does the Jewish Agency assist in acquiring Israeli Citizenship? Posted on June 24, 2013

The Jewish Agency for Israeli has offices in many countries where one seeking Israeli citizenship may get advice and assistance. But remember Agency officials, as any clerk, are subject to protocols and procedures and in many cases errors and mistakes occur during the filling out of forms, their submission and selection of manner of submission, and applicants have been delayed a long time, and in some instances, the citizenship application was denied. Needless to say, such a result carries with it many legal complications including the need to apply to the courts in general and dealing with the Ministry of the Interior in particular.
